⚡ Charting in Korea

Charting libraries and tools help developers create interactive charts, graphs, and data visualizations for websites and applications.

Korea is an East Asian country with a population of around 52 million people.

According to our data, charting libraries are detected on 1.6% of websites from Korea.

⭐ Most Popular in 2026

The following chart shows the top charting libraries in Korea in 2026, based on market share.

The most popular is Chart.js with an impressive share of 32%, followed by D3.js with 24.8% and Easy Pie Chart with 19.5%.
